SVG Working Group Charter Review and Work in progress on CSS Working Group Charter

This is an update on SVG charter review and notice of work in progress
on an addition to the CSS charter:

Despite efforts in 2016 to continue SVG work, the level of participation
in the SVG Working Group has been insufficient and recent attempt to
reframe the Working Group did not receive enough support. While work on
the SVG2 specification has been really useful to improve the
specification, the specification was ahead of implementations, without
sufficient implementation experience to deploy those features on the
Web. In addition, the attention of some of the relevant technical
individuals has been split between the graphics efforts in the CSS
Working Group and the SVG Working Group.

W3C has been looking at potential alternatives since January and is
asking the CSS Working Group if they would be willing to help with the
maintenance of the SVG specification [1], since some of the Graphics
expertise as well as the individuals involved would be helpful. The
current proposal is
